One of the most legendary attributes of samurai swords is their curved condition. This curvature was not accidental; it absolutely was produced to further improve reducing performance in the course of mounted beat. Not like straight swords, the curved blade permits smoother slicing motions, which makes it more practical in battle predicaments exactly where pace and precision mattered. The most renowned variety of samurai sword may be the katana, which grew to become the conventional weapon in the samurai course. Together with it, warriors also carried shorter blades such as the wakizashi and tanto, forming a pair called the daishō, which represented the samurai’s social position and private identity.

The crafting of samurai swords is surely an artwork sort in alone, deeply rooted in tradition and spiritual self-discipline. Swordsmiths, generally known as tosho, adopted demanding rituals during the forging procedure. The steel utilised, often known as tamahagane, was manufactured from iron sand and punctiliously refined via repeated heating and folding. This folding procedure eliminated impurities and developed the unique layered pattern observed on several genuine blades. The forging of samurai swords also concerned a complex warmth-treatment process that combined tricky and tender metal, leading to a blade that was the two sharp and flexible. This equilibrium of toughness and resilience is without doubt one of the explanations samurai swords remain admired nowadays.

The design of samurai swords also reflects a wonderful mixture of engineering and aesthetics. The cope with, or tsuka, is meticulously wrapped in silk or cotton for grip and comfort. The guard, or tsuba, is usually intricately decorated with artistic motifs, in some cases depicting mother nature, mythology, or household crests. Even the scabbard, or saya, is crafted with precision to guard the blade when keeping elegance. Every ingredient of samurai swords is made with the two function and sweetness in mind, earning them Fantastic examples of common craftsmanship.
